The Mouseprice Value Guide tells you how the asking price of a property compares to the market price of other properties with similar attributes including property type, location and floor area. Note that some aspects of a property are not considered by the Value Guide such as the condition and home improvements so it is important you do your own research.

Situated in an extremely central position within Brentwood, which is just minutes from the mainline railway station and High Street, is this immaculately presented four bedroom family home which measures 2462 square feet. The property has been lovingly updated throughout, and the accommodation includes a beautiful fitted kitchen and matching utility by ‘Tom Howley,‘ two large reception rooms and a stunning master bedroom suite with fitted bedroom furniture and an en-suite shower room. There are also three further bedrooms, a study and luxurious family bathroom. Externally are two off street parking spaces and a well kept rear garden.
